Barbara E. (Cox), age 98, a resident of Canton and a longtime former resident of Norwood and Brewster, passed away peacefully on the morning of Friday, May 15, 2026, at Cornerstone Assisted Living in Canton. She was the devoted wife of the late Robert J. Crossen, Sr.

Born on April 28, 1928, in Providence, RI, Barbara was one of two children and the only daughter of the late Francis J. Cox, Sr. and Alice V. (Keighley) Cox. She was raised in Providence and attended St. Francis Xavier Academy, graduating with the Class of 1946. She later continued her education at Bryant College.

Following her marriage to her beloved husband, Bob, Barbara moved from Rhode Island to Hyde Park, where they began raising their family. They later settled in Norwood, where she lived for many years. In time, Barbara and her husband relocated to Cape Cod, making their home in Brewster, where she cherished the charm and tranquility of the Cape. In her later years, she returned to the Norwood area to be closer to her family.

A woman of deep and abiding faith, Barbara was an active parishioner at St. Catherine of Siena Parish in Norwood and Our Lady of the Cape in Brewster. She was a devoted participant in parish life, including membership in the Catholic women’s societies at both churches.

In her spare time, Barbara enjoyed traveling and embraced the simple joys of life. Above all, she treasured time spent with her family, creating lasting memories with her children, grandchildren, great-grandchildren, and great-great-grandchild.

Barbara is survived by her loving children: Catherine Avellino and her husband Vincent of Braintree; Susan Pepin and her late husband James of Norwood; Robert J. Crossen, Jr. and his wife Margaret of Norwood; and John Crossen and his wife Mary of Hull. She was the proud and devoted grandmother of nine grandchildren, eight great-grandchildren, and one great-great-grandchild. She is also survived by many beloved nieces, nephews, and extended family members.

In addition to her parents and her husband, Barbara was predeceased by her brother, Francis J. Cox, Jr.
